Key differences

Both WLTG and WINN are equity ETFs. WLTG charges 0.74% a year and WINN 0.57%. The main difference: WINN costs 0.17% less per year.

  • WINN costs 0.17% less per year.
  • WINN is much larger than WLTG. Larger funds are usually more liquid and less likely to close.
